The typical home in 32836 is worth $805,474 — 106.8% above the Orlando-Kissimmee-Sanford, FL median. Over the past year, values have fallen 0.3%. Homes here rent for a typical $2,108 a month — a 3.1% gross rental yield. The effective property tax rate is 0.8%.
